1042.04   UNREASONABLE BURDENS UPON SYSTEM.
   If the character of sewage from any manufacturing or industrial plant or any other building or premises shall be such as to impose an unreasonable additional burden upon the sewers of the system, then an additional charge may be made over and above the regular rates, or it may be required that such sewage be treated by the person, firm or corporation responsible therefor before being emptied into the sewer, or the right to empty such sewer may be denied, if necessary, for the protection of the sewer and sewage disposal facilities of the system or the public health or safety.
